Minnie Langley was born in 1907 in Gerogetown, SC, the child of John T Langley And Susanna Beale. In 1920, Minnie Langley resided in Mingo, Williamsburg, South Carolina, USA. In 1930, Minnie Langley resided in Mingo, Williamsburg, South Carolina, USA. Minnie Langley married Edd J Cunningham, and had children including Bethel Cunningham, Eddie Lee Cunningham, Florrie Cunningham, James Cunningham, Letha Cunningham, Lorry Cunningham, Rose Cunningham. Minnie Langley passed away in 1952 in Georgetown, South Carolina, USA.
